Форум программистов
 
О проблемах, например, с регистрацией пишите сюда - alarforum@yandex.ru, проверяйте папку спам! Обязательно пройдите активизацию e-mail, а тут можно восстановить пароль.

Вернуться   Форум программистов > .NET > WPF, UWP, WinRT, XAML
Регистрация

Восстановить пароль
Повторная активизация e-mail

Здесь нужно купить рекламу за 20 тыс руб в месяц! ) пишите сюда - alarforum@yandex.ru
Без учёта ботов - 20000 человек в день, 350000 в месяц.

Ответ
 
Опции темы
Старый 20.03.2016, 15:12   #1
Ar4ipers
Новичок
Джуниор
 
Регистрация: 20.03.2016
Сообщений: 1
По умолчанию Изменение данных в DataGrid

Доброго времени суток, столкнулся с проблемкой, когда я изменяю данный в DataGrid (Двойным кликом мыши -> меняю какие-то данные -> нажимаю Enter) , а затем сохраняю, то сохраняются данные которые были до изменения
private void SaveButton_Click(object sender, RoutedEventArgs e)
{
XmlDocument xmlDoc = new XmlDocument();
XmlNode rootNode = xmlDoc.CreateElement(nameof(Receipt s));
xmlDoc.AppendChild(rootNode);

foreach (var item in Receipts)
{
var userNode = xmlDoc.CreateElement(nameof(Receipt ));
var attribute = xmlDoc.CreateAttribute(nameof(item. Date));
attribute.Value = item.Date.ToString();
userNode.Attributes.Append(attribut e);

var subNode = xmlDoc.CreateElement(nameof(item.Nu mber));
subNode.InnerText = item.Number.ToString();
userNode.AppendChild(subNode);

subNode = xmlDoc.CreateElement(nameof(item.Na meOperation));
subNode.InnerText = item.NameOperation.ToString();
userNode.AppendChild(subNode);

subNode = xmlDoc.CreateElement(nameof(item.Co st));
subNode.InnerText = item.Cost.ToString();
userNode.AppendChild(subNode);

rootNode.AppendChild(userNode);
}
xmlDoc.Save("XML123.xml");
}
Как можно исправить данную проблему, заранее спасибо
Вложения
Тип файла: rar WpfApplication1.rar (80.8 Кб, 8 просмотров)

Последний раз редактировалось Ar4ipers; 20.03.2016 в 15:20.
Ar4ipers вне форума Ответить с цитированием
Ответ

Здесь нужно купить рекламу за 20 тыс руб в месяц! ) пишите сюда - alarforum@yandex.ru
Без учёта ботов - 20000 человек в день, 350000 в месяц.

Опции темы


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Вывод данных в datagrid Notan1310 WPF, UWP, WinRT, XAML 1 15.08.2015 13:31
Отображение данных в DataGrid (WPF) hameen WPF, UWP, WinRT, XAML 1 04.07.2013 17:02
Базы данных изменение данных (Delphi (ADO)). RuthlessD Помощь студентам 0 16.06.2011 18:57
Изменение данных и перенос данных из одной таб в другую Kot9ra Microsoft Office Access 13 02.07.2010 11:22


Проекты отопления, пеллетные котлы, бойлеры, радиаторы
интернет магазин respective.ru
Пеллетный котёл Emtas
котлы EMTAS